Section 1.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Maryland,
That new Sections 19C and 19D be and they are hereby added to
Article 59 of the Annotated Code of Maryland (1964 Replacement
Volume), title "Lunatics and Insane", subtitle "Department of
Mental Hygiene", to follow immediately after Section 19B thereof,
and to read as follows:

19C.

There shall be a center and hospital for psychiatric research to be
known as the Maryland Psychiatric Research Center. It will focus
on the prevention, causes and treatment of mental illness and allied
conditions with the powers and duties as provided in this article and
elsewhere in the laws of the State. Said center shall be established
in Catonsville, Maryland, on the grounds of Spring Grove State
Hospital.

19D.

(a)   The Maryland Psychiatric Research Center shall be within
the administrative control, supervision and direction of the Depart-
ment of Mental Hygiene.

(b)   The Commissioner of Mental Hygiene upon the approval of
the Board of Health and Mental Hygiene shall appoint a director of
said research who shall be subject to the provisions of the Merit
System law. The director shall be a well-qualified psychiatrist who
shall be experienced in the various aspects of psychiatric research.
In addition to functioning as the director of the Maryland Psychi-
atric Research Center, said director will function as the Director of
Research for the Department of Mental Hygiene.

The director shall receive such compensation as shall be provided
in the budget, shall be responsible to the Commissioner of Mental
Hygiene for the operation of the center in his charge, and shall
submit to the Department such reports, including medical and finan-
cial, as the Department of Mental Hygiene may request. It shall be
the duty of the director to inform the Department of Mental Hygiene
of the conditions in his center, and to order that such changes as
seem desirable for the welfare of the patients, who may be there for
special treatment, be put into effect, with the approval of the
Department of Mental Hygiene.

(c)  All other appointments of personnel at said center shall be
made by the director thereof under the provisions of the Merit
System law.

(d)  Patients shall be admitted to the Maryland Psychiatric Re-
search Center only as transfers from the State psychiatric hospitals
and State hospitals for the retarded.

Sec. 2. And be it further enacted, That this Act shall take effect
June 1, 1967.

Approved April 21, 1967.
